#a188ee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a188ee is composed of 63.1% red, 53.3% green and 93.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32.4% cyan, 42.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 254.7 degrees, a saturation of 75% and a lightness of 73.3%. #a188ee color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#4311dd. Closest websafe color is: #9999ff.

Shades and Tints of #a188ee

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#f2effd is the lightest one.

Tones of #a188ee

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b9b7bf is the less saturated color, while #9978fe is the most saturated one.
